Key Facts
- "The Secret Lives of Mormon Wives" is a popular show on Hulu, releasing multiple seasons in one year.
- Shinia Powell, not part of the main cast, appears in two seasons of the show.
- Powell was involved in a significant storyline where her friend Taylor Frankie Paul discovers Powell's relationship with Paul's ex-boyfriend, Dakota Mortensen.
- Powell is a Utah-based influencer with two kids, previously married to McKoy Allred.
- Powell has been friends with Miranda McWhorter, who is also in the show and was involved in persuading Powell to end her relationship with Mortensen.
- There is tension and drama in the show involving these personal relationships, and it has been a central part of recent episodes.
- The drama became publicly known when Paul posted about the relationship between Powell and Mortensen on social media.
